Transaction 322581471d200b84676560d773057c6dc15149207f851c1e8716e54d7f8bf4db

1 Input
2 Outputs
  • 322581471d200b84676560d773057c6dc15149207f851c1e8716e54d7f8bf4db:0
  • value  124060
    address  3G7nnrsrypWiJuPM9oAgsipFzxwSLq5f9n
  • 322581471d200b84676560d773057c6dc15149207f851c1e8716e54d7f8bf4db:1
  • value  1280907
    address  1HuQaMQFsoF5iPeGE3nJcJVBiDe3aMKjeQ